Idled rail box cars at a railroad marshaling yard in the United States during World War I.

View of a railroad marshaling yard in the United States, filled with idle box cars. The cars had been idled due to the German U-boat campaigns affecting maritime commerce from the United States to its allies in World War I.

A merchant ship idle at dock of a New York pier, with a U.S. flag on it, during World War I.

Clip shows a merchant ship at dock in New York. It is idle, awaiting resolution from United States legislators, as the U.S. Senate filibusters President Wilson's call to arm merchant ships (against the U-boat threat from Germany in World War I, before America entered the war).

French actress Sarah Bernhardt arrives in New York City following a visit to the French front in World War I

French actress Sara Bernhardt is wheeled down the gangplank from the French ocean liner Espagne in New York City. She has returned on the passenger ship from a visit to France and the French front during World War 1. She stands up from her wheel chair and addresses the crowd on the dock. Bernhardt drapes an American flag over her lap and over the side of a car in which she is sitting. She committed the profits of her tour in the U.S. to French widows and orphans of the war.

Battle of Blair Mountain, in Logan County, West Virginia,1921

Scenes from the labor dispute and uprising known as the Battle of Blair Mountain. Opening scene shows Sheriff's Deputies firing down upon miners from a hillside in Logan County, West Virginia. One of them is armed with a Model 1917 Browning machine gun. Scene shifts to group of Union miners, cleaning and adjusting their rifles and shotguns. One wears a metal Army helmet. Several more pose for the camera, holding their guns. One of them also wears an Army steel helmet. They check the actions of their weapons. Closeup of one in a steel helmet. Next scene shows miner families leaving the area in horse-drawn wagons. Change of scene shows a group of men boarding a railroad train car. An armed U.S. Army soldier in uniform stands nearby. The final scene shows Sheriff Don Chafin of Logan County, posing with U.S. Army Brigadier General Henry H. Bandholtz.
